Output 105c1e546a753572d3680d50b9314f1aac94af6f9cd8dc3b56ae407b3b82fb62:3

value
1046377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ddc127e95c0b5c7be332c3f6f767a574343f15b OP_EQUAL
address
3AFJQGhoMTSRgJXSCvPA5P3eHfTDYJBebK
transaction
105c1e546a753572d3680d50b9314f1aac94af6f9cd8dc3b56ae407b3b82fb62
spent
true